**Q: The Fillwise restock planner won't generate routes after a release. What now?**

A: Usually the route cache is stale. Flush it from the Fillwise admin panel, then rerun the planner for one depot (use Marrowgate as the test case) before enabling all depots. If the admin panel rejects your release-manager session — which happens after schema migrations — recover access via the break-glass flow. At the break-glass prompt, enter the passphrase given below.

vault phrase of tajef-tafog = istox-sorax-zorox-casok-holox-kelix-weneth-drueth-casion

Q: Why did my plugin stop receiving reminder events from the Carbury Clinic scheduler job?

A: The Remindle job batches appointment reminders hourly. If your plugin misses three consecutive delivery attempts, it is auto-suspended. Check your webhook handler's response codes, re-enable the subscription in the dev console, and replay missed batches from the last 48 hours. Unresolved suspensions after replay should be reported to the integrations desk.

alerts address for fafop-tajog: keleth.joreth.fravan@qorvelhq.corp

### Runbook: Report export timezone mismatches (Glimmerfield)

If a customer reports that exported totals differ from the dashboard, check whether their report schedule predates the March cutover — older schedules still render in server-local time rather than the account timezone. Re-saving the schedule fixes it. Before escalating, confirm the export worker is running with the expected timezone settings shown below.

config for kadup-kajog:
[raldor]
host = raldor.tolvaqworks.internal
user = raldor_svc
database = raldor_prod

Q3 Planning Note — Reseller Programme

The Veltrix reseller programme added eleven partners last quarter, with the Marlow Bay and Ostenfeld territories performing ahead of forecast. Margin tiers will be simplified from four bands to two, effective next cycle, and onboarding will move to the Cairnhold portal. Department heads should flag staffing needs for partner support by Friday. Certification renewals remain mandatory. The confidential note below outlines how the programme fits our wider commercial plans.

confidential, kagup-bafog: Fraaxax Group is in early talks to buy Soroxox Group for about $343.8 million. The Olidor launch date is June 14, and nothing goes to the press before then. Legal wants the Aldmirek Logistics term sheet signed before July 23.